Job Summary

The Quality Assurance Manager is responsible for ensuring the quality and safety of products while meeting company and regulatory standards. This role involves overseeing a continuous quality improvement program, including quality control and quality assurance, and communicating quality results to the workforce.

Key Responsibilities
  • Manage laboratory operations and activities.
  • Ensure product safety, regulatory compliance, and adherence to company standards.
  • Drive continuous improvement efforts in product quality and process optimization.
  • Provide leadership in coaching, education, and training of management staff and plant employees for Quality Assurance and Food Safety.
  • Develop, facilitate, and maintain the aseptic products HACCP program.
  • Review product labels and ensure adherence to regulatory and company standards.
  • Supervise chemical, bacteriological, sensory, and utilization tests on raw materials.
  • Lead problem-solving efforts through team meetings and on-the-floor leadership.
  • Communicate quality metrics, results, and inspection results to management and leadership.
  • Ensure proper sanitation procedures and adequate sanitation tests.
  • Develop and maintain documentation of quality tests and activities.
  • Lead local, state, customer/third-party, and federal audits and inspections.
  • Manage department budget, expense management, and control.
  • Ensure adherence to contract packaging quality requirements.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ams as a change agent.
  • Lead by example with the Saputo Code of Ethics and apply the Saputo Values.
Requirements
  • Bachelor's degree in a science-based area of study and a minimum of 3 years of supervisory level experience.
  • Familiarity with Good Manufacturing Practices.
  • Working knowledge of sanitation systems, techniques, and procedures.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Understanding of change management basics.
  • Ability to adapt to changing organizational and operational needs.
  • Ability to handle multiple tasks simultaneously.
  • Strong team player and leader with the ability to work across multiple functions and disciplines.
